Child Care

Explore the career of an infant caretaker. Students learn about typical duties performed and tools/equipment used in child care. Using life-size simulated babies and supplies, students will explore the proper techniques for holding, lifting and carrying an infant; feeding an infant; diapering an infant; and dressing and bathing an infant.
